91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

php數組去除重復值的方法

發布時間:2020-11-06 10:02:28 來源:億速云 閱讀:190 作者:小新 欄目:編程語言

小編給大家分享一下php數組去除重復值的方法,相信大部分人都還不怎么了解,因此分享這篇文章給大家參考一下,希望大家閱讀完這篇文章后大有收獲,下面讓我們一起去了解一下吧!

PHP中可以使用array_unique()函數來去除數組的重復值;如果兩個或更多個數組值相同,array_unique()函數只會保留第一個元素,其他的元素值會被刪除;語法格式“array_unique(array)”。

array_unique() 定義和用法

array_unique() 函數移除數組中的重復的值,并返回結果數組。

當幾個數組元素的值相等時,只保留第一個元素,其他的元素被刪除。

返回的數組中鍵名不變。

語法

array_unique(array)

參數

  • array 必需。規定輸入的數組。

說明

  • array_unique() 先將值作為字符串排序,然后對每個值只保留第一個遇到的鍵名,接著忽略所有后面的鍵名。這并不意味著在未排序的 array 中同一個值的第一個出現的鍵名會被保留。

返回值:返回過濾后的數組。被返回的數組將保持第一個數組元素的鍵類型。

示例1:

<?php
$a1=array("a"=>"red","b"=>"green","c"=>"red");
$a2=array("1"=>"Cat","2"=>"Dog","3"=>"Cat","4"=>"rabbit");
var_dump(array_unique($a1));
var_dump(array_unique($a2));
?>

輸出:

array (size=2)
  'a' => string 'red' (length=3)
  'b' => string 'green' (length=5)
array (size=3)
  1 => string 'Cat' (length=3)
  2 => string 'Dog' (length=3)
  4 => string 'rabbit' (length=6)

示例2:

<?php
$result1 = array("a" => "green", "red", "b" => "green", "blue", "red");
var_dump($result1);
$result2 = array_unique($result1);
var_dump($result2);
?>

輸出:

array (size=5)
  'a' => string 'green' (length=5)
  0 => string 'red' (length=3)
  'b' => string 'green' (length=5)
  1 => string 'blue' (length=4)
  2 => string 'red' (length=3)
array (size=3)
  'a' => string 'green' (length=5)
  0 => string 'red' (length=3)
  1 => string 'blue' (length=4)

以上是php數組去除重復值的方法的所有內容,感謝各位的閱讀!相信大家都有了一定的了解,希望分享的內容對大家有所幫助,如果還想學習更多知識,歡迎關注億速云行業資訊頻道!

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

嘉荫县| 原阳县| 东城区| 远安县| 武平县| 清水河县| 石嘴山市| 册亨县| 鸡西市| 田林县| 翁牛特旗| 大厂| 突泉县| 威海市| 马关县| 灵丘县| 将乐县| 天门市| 隆昌县| 美姑县| 眉山市| 大邑县| 红安县| 开封县| 新干县| 库伦旗| 富源县| 临桂县| 巴彦县| 河西区| 夹江县| 榆树市| 格尔木市| 古丈县| 寿光市| 鹤峰县| 平泉县| 宜川县| 宝应县| 洛川县| 同仁县|